Be a part of the excitement at the highest elevation Archery Challenge in the country at Easterseals Colorado's 5th Annual Archery Challenge - located at Loveland Ski Area in Arapaho National Forest! Mark your calendars for July 26 & 27, 2024, and aim for a weekend of bows, arrows, and making a difference. This event supports Easterseals Colorado's Rocky Mountain Village Camp and helps empower children and adults living with disabilities. Register now and help us hit the bullseye for a great cause!

Format
The Archery Challenge will consist of one (1) target on eighteen (18) stations on the Competing and Non-Competing Courses, and eight (8) stations on the ADA Course. Archers must bring their own bow and arrows – 12 arrows are recommended.
Bring your own RV or tent if you wish to camp overnight on Friday, July 26 for a small fee. No hook-ups or power provided. There are bathrooms on site that can be used. No open fires.
